Ingredients

3 tbs butter

3 tbs flour

2 cup milk

salt

white pepper

1 tsp garlic powder

½ tsp cayenne pepper

1 tsp paprika

a pinch nutmeg

1 block cheddar cheese

10 potatoes

olive oil

parsley

pepper

Directions

Step 1

Melt butter and whisk together with flour over the stove.

Step 2

Slowly whisk in 2 cups of milk while still on the heat.

Step 3

Season with salt and white pepper, then add garlic powder, cayenne pepper, paprika and grated nutmeg. Whisk together.

Step 4

Add in shredded cheddar cheese and mix.

Step 5

Using a mandolin, thinly slice potatoes then season with salt, pepper and some olive oil before laying in a baking dish.

Step 6

Pour the cheese sauce over the potatoes, cover with foil and bake at 200°C (390°F) for 30 mins.

Step 7

Uncover, sprinkle more shredded cheddar cheese over the top and then let brown in the oven.

Step 8

Garnish with parsley and enjoy!
